婷婷综合国产,91蜜桃婷婷狠狠久久综合9色 ,九九九九九精品,国产综合av

主頁 > 知識庫 > MySQL存儲引擎中MyISAM和InnoDB區別詳解

MySQL存儲引擎中MyISAM和InnoDB區別詳解

熱門標簽:清遠申請400電話 桂林云電銷機器人收費 東莞外呼企業管理系統 沈陽智能外呼系統供應商 如何選擇優質的外呼系統 手機外呼系統違法嗎 南通電銷外呼系統哪家強 地圖簡圖標注 谷歌地圖標注位置圖解

InnoDB和MyISAM是許多人在使用MySQL時最常用的兩個表類型,這兩個表類型各有優劣,視具體應用而定。基本的差別為:MyISAM類型不支持事務處理等高級處理,而InnoDB類型支持。MyISAM類型的表強調的是性能,其執行數度比InnoDB類型更快,但是不提供事務支持,而InnoDB提供事務支持以及外部鍵等高級數據庫功能。

  以下是一些細節和具體實現的差別:

  ◆1.InnoDB不支持FULLTEXT類型的索引。
  ◆2.InnoDB 中不保存表的具體行數,也就是說,執行select count() from table時,InnoDB要掃描一遍整個表來計算有多少行,但是MyISAM只要簡單的讀出保存好的行數即可。注意的是,當count()語句包含 where條件時,兩種表的操作是一樣的。
  ◆3.對于AUTO_INCREMENT類型的字段,InnoDB中必須包含只有該字段的索引,但是在MyISAM表中,可以和其他字段一起建立聯合索引。
  ◆4.DELETE FROM table時,InnoDB不會重新建立表,而是一行一行的刪除。
  ◆5.LOAD TABLE FROM MASTER操作對InnoDB是不起作用的,解決方法是首先把InnoDB表改成MyISAM表,導入數據后再改成InnoDB表,但是對于使用的額外的InnoDB特性(例如外鍵)的表不適用。

  另外,InnoDB表的行鎖也不是絕對的,假如在執行一個SQL語句時MySQL不能確定要掃描的范圍,InnoDB表同樣會鎖全表,例如update table set num=1 where name like “%aaa%”

  兩種類型最主要的差別就是Innodb 支持事務處理與外鍵和行級鎖。而MyISAM不支持.所以MyISAM往往就容易被人認為只適合在小項目中使用。

  作為使用MySQL的用戶角度出發,Innodb和MyISAM都是比較喜歡的,如果數據庫平臺要達到需求:99.9%的穩定性,方便的擴展性和高可用性來說的話,MyISAM絕對是首選。

  原因如下:

  1、平臺上承載的大部分項目是讀多寫少的項目,而MyISAM的讀性能是比Innodb強不少的。

  2、MyISAM的索引和數據是分開的,并且索引是有壓縮的,內存使用率就對應提高了不少。能加載更多索引,而Innodb是索引和數據是緊密捆綁的,沒有使用壓縮從而會造成Innodb比MyISAM體積龐大不小。

  3、經常隔1,2個月就會發生應用開發人員不小心update一個表where寫的范圍不對,導致這個表沒法正常用了,這個時候MyISAM的優越性就體現出來了,隨便從當天拷貝的壓縮包取出對應表的文件,隨便放到一個數據庫目錄下,然后dump成sql再導回到主庫,并把對應的binlog補上。如果是Innodb,恐怕不可能有這么快速度,別和我說讓Innodb定期用導出xxx.sql機制備份,因為最小的一個數據庫實例的數據量基本都是幾十G大小。

  4、從接觸的應用邏輯來說,select count(*) 和order by 是最頻繁的,大概能占了整個sql總語句的60%以上的操作,而這種操作Innodb其實也是會鎖表的,很多人以為Innodb是行級鎖,那個只是where對它主鍵是有效,非主鍵的都會鎖全表的。

  5、還有就是經常有很多應用部門需要我給他們定期某些表的數據,MyISAM的話很方便,只要發給他們對應那表的frm.MYD,MYI的文件,讓他們自己在對應版本的數據庫啟動就行,而Innodb就需要導出xxx.sql了,因為光給別人文件,受字典數據文件的影響,對方是無法使用的。

  6、如果和MyISAM比insert寫操作的話,Innodb還達不到MyISAM的寫性能,如果是針對基于索引的update操作,雖然MyISAM可能會遜色Innodb,但是那么高并發的寫,從庫能否追的上也是一個問題,還不如通過多實例分庫分表架構來解決。

  7、如果是用MyISAM的話,merge引擎可以大大加快應用部門的開發速度,他們只要對這個merge表做一些select count(*)操作,非常適合大項目總量約幾億的rows某一類型(如日志,調查統計)的業務表。

  當然Innodb也不是絕對不用,用事務的項目就用Innodb的。另外,可能有人會說你MyISAM無法抗太多寫操作,但是可以通過架構來彌補。

您可能感興趣的文章:
  • MySQL存儲引擎MyISAM與InnoDB區別總結整理
  • MySQL存儲引擎中的MyISAM和InnoDB區別詳解
  • Mysql存儲引擎InnoDB和Myisam的六大區別
  • Mysql 的存儲引擎,myisam和innodb的區別
  • MySQL存儲引擎MyISAM與InnoDB的9點區別
  • MySQL存儲引擎簡介及MyISAM和InnoDB的區別
  • MySQL存儲引擎 InnoDB與MyISAM的區別
  • Mysql中存儲引擎的區別及比較

標簽:成都 重慶 臨沂 湖州 內蒙古 貴州 天津 常德

巨人網絡通訊聲明:本文標題《MySQL存儲引擎中MyISAM和InnoDB區別詳解》,本文關鍵詞  MySQL,存儲,引擎,中,MyISAM,;如發現本文內容存在版權問題,煩請提供相關信息告之我們,我們將及時溝通與處理。本站內容系統采集于網絡,涉及言論、版權與本站無關。
  • 相關文章
  • 下面列出與本文章《MySQL存儲引擎中MyISAM和InnoDB區別詳解》相關的同類信息!
  • 本頁收集關于MySQL存儲引擎中MyISAM和InnoDB區別詳解的相關信息資訊供網民參考!
  • 推薦文章
    婷婷综合国产,91蜜桃婷婷狠狠久久综合9色 ,九九九九九精品,国产综合av
    成人黄页在线观看| 一道本成人在线| 欧美一区二区视频在线观看| 国产资源在线一区| 亚洲一区精品在线| 一区二区三区欧美在线观看| 精品福利在线导航| 色综合中文字幕| 国产在线观看一区二区| 日韩二区三区四区| 久久夜色精品国产噜噜av| 精品久久久久香蕉网| 国内精品伊人久久久久av一坑| 国产主播一区二区三区| 欧美性一区二区| 91久久奴性调教| 欧美日韩精品二区第二页| 亚洲精品videosex极品| 韩国精品久久久| 91精品国产91久久久久久最新毛片| 国产精品视频线看| youjizz久久| 一区免费观看视频| 成人黄色av网站在线| 亚洲国产成人一区二区三区| 国产精品影视天天线| 91精品国产91久久久久久最新毛片| 国产精品第四页| 久草这里只有精品视频| 蜜桃视频在线观看一区二区| 成人一区二区三区在线观看| 青青草精品视频| 99久久综合99久久综合网站| 一区二区三区在线看| 久久精品国产成人一区二区三区| 亚洲精选一二三| 综合av第一页| 夜夜操天天操亚洲| 亚洲一级在线观看| 亚洲h在线观看| 天天综合色天天| 蜜臀av性久久久久蜜臀aⅴ流畅| 亚洲国产精品视频| 日韩一区二区精品葵司在线 | 蜜臀久久99精品久久久久久9| 日韩一区精品视频| 日韩精品一区二| 久久亚洲私人国产精品va媚药| 久久久亚洲精品石原莉奈| 中文字幕国产精品一区二区| 国产精品国产三级国产三级人妇| 亚洲乱码日产精品bd| 曰韩精品一区二区| 蜜桃精品在线观看| 成人夜色视频网站在线观看| 成人免费看黄yyy456| eeuss国产一区二区三区| 欧美中文字幕一区二区三区 | 日韩电影在线免费| 国内精品视频666| 色综合久久99| 99精品久久免费看蜜臀剧情介绍| 7777精品伊人久久久大香线蕉最新版| 欧洲亚洲精品在线| 高清久久久久久| aaa欧美色吧激情视频| 福利电影一区二区三区| 麻豆视频观看网址久久| 福利一区福利二区| 亚洲欧美日韩一区二区| 亚洲色图视频网| 亚洲精品免费一二三区| 久久综合资源网| 亚洲欧洲在线观看av| 麻豆极品一区二区三区| 一本一道波多野结衣一区二区| 日韩欧美一区二区免费| 亚洲蜜桃精久久久久久久| 亚洲成人资源网| 精品国产欧美一区二区| 欧美亚州韩日在线看免费版国语版| 国产欧美日韩另类视频免费观看| 伊人一区二区三区| 韩国视频一区二区| 欧美喷潮久久久xxxxx| 精品久久久久久久久久久久久久久 | 亚洲精选在线视频| 99久久婷婷国产精品综合| 国产精品久久久久婷婷| 成人午夜又粗又硬又大| 亚洲人成亚洲人成在线观看图片| 国产精品三级久久久久三级| 国产在线视频不卡二| 国产精品三级视频| 蜜桃久久久久久久| 麻豆精品精品国产自在97香蕉| 欧美国产精品一区二区三区| 成人免费看视频| 欧美日韩一级二级| 成人激情动漫在线观看| av日韩在线网站| 亚洲女子a中天字幕| 在线精品观看国产| 亚洲欧美日韩国产综合| 欧美三级资源在线| 国产美女主播视频一区| 久久日一线二线三线suv| 色综合中文字幕国产 | 精品国产一区二区三区四区四 | 欧美大片日本大片免费观看| 东方aⅴ免费观看久久av| 国产精品一区二区黑丝| 欧美一区二区视频网站| 日韩欧美国产wwwww| 欧美日韩国产中文| 91丨porny丨国产入口| 亚洲欧美aⅴ...| www久久久久| 国产精品1区2区| 国产精品国产三级国产aⅴ中文| 欧美日韩亚洲综合在线| 久久网这里都是精品| 国产午夜一区二区三区| 一级日本不卡的影视| 国产精品美日韩| 亚洲免费色视频| 亚洲人成网站影音先锋播放| www国产成人免费观看视频 深夜成人网| 91精品国产综合久久久久久久久久| 不卡电影一区二区三区| 精品在线播放免费| www成人在线观看| 久久久精品国产免大香伊| 国产一区二区精品久久99| 国产麻豆9l精品三级站| 久久精品国产免费| 国产91在线看| 欧美日韩一区中文字幕| 欧美三级日韩在线| 亚洲精品视频免费看| 成人app下载| 精品国产一区二区在线观看| 韩日欧美一区二区三区| 欧美亚洲另类激情小说| 五月天激情小说综合| 日韩三级中文字幕| 91一区二区在线| 紧缚奴在线一区二区三区| 国产精品乱子久久久久| 日韩一级黄色片| 日本精品一区二区三区高清 | 欧美主播一区二区三区| 精品少妇一区二区三区日产乱码| 国产清纯白嫩初高生在线观看91| 无码av中文一区二区三区桃花岛| 国产成人免费视频一区| 欧美tickling挠脚心丨vk| 国产欧美日韩在线| 韩国av一区二区三区在线观看| 国产精品无码永久免费888| 免费成人美女在线观看.| 久久久久久黄色| 欧美综合一区二区| 久久国产精品99久久久久久老狼| 欧美一区二区三区免费观看视频| 亚洲www啪成人一区二区麻豆| 91福利在线播放| 久久99蜜桃精品| 亚洲激情图片一区| 日韩午夜激情电影| 91视视频在线直接观看在线看网页在线看 | 国产精品久久一级| 国产白丝网站精品污在线入口| 国产成人精品网址| 中文字幕日韩一区| 欧美一区二区三区四区高清| 国产成人av一区二区三区在线 | 国产呦萝稀缺另类资源| 亚洲综合丁香婷婷六月香| 国产成人福利片| 555www色欧美视频| 欧美精选一区二区| 欧美人牲a欧美精品| 在线视频一区二区三区| 成人午夜在线免费| 26uuu精品一区二区三区四区在线| 蜜桃一区二区三区在线观看| 久久综合狠狠综合久久综合88| 成人av网站免费观看| 男人操女人的视频在线观看欧美| 欧美成人乱码一区二区三区| 色婷婷综合五月| 成人av网址在线| jvid福利写真一区二区三区| 久久er精品视频| 麻豆精品一区二区三区| 亚洲成人www| 日韩精品成人一区二区在线| 国产精品你懂的在线| 国产日韩欧美精品在线|